Laurus nobilis is the classic evergreen bay, prized for its aromatic leaves used in cooking and for its neat, formal look when clipped. This half-standard form carries a rounded crown above a clear stem, ideal for flanking doorways, patios and paths, or for smart container displays. Slow-growing and easy to shape, it thrives in sun or light shade in a sheltered spot with fertile, well-drained soil. In spring it may produce small, pale yellow-green flowers (with berries forming on female plants), but it is chiefly grown for its dense, glossy foliage. Light clipping in late spring or summer will keep the crown tight and well-defined.
This is a standard tree with a clear stem and a shaped crown above. The tree was grown up to this stem height and then pruned to stop the trunk growing taller. The clear stem will remain at the height you receive it at, with future growth coming from the top of the tree.
